CONCEPT 1: INTRINSIC MOTIVATION
Definition: Taking a certain action for the sake of enjoyment, it will lead us to be
more fully engaged, greater curiosity and pleasure.
Joe saw a basketball tournament advertisement along the street while walking back home in the evening. He got interested and decided to join the competition with his group of friends.
CONCEPT 2: SOCIAL LEARNING PERSPECTIVE
Definition: This perspective argues that individuals learns observing the behaviours of
others. Individuals tend to observe modelled behaviours and, in turn behave in a similar manner.
After they decided to join the tournament, they learn more skills and strategy by observing some professional players through television. After observing, Joe and his teammates went to practice the skills that they’ve learnt.
CONCEPT 3: STEREOTYPE ( PREJUDICE)
Definition: Stereotype is a learned attitude toward
a group of people. Prejudice is a negative learned attitude
towards a group of people.
They did not managed to claim the gold medal, his teammates blamed him for the cause of losing the game because of his physical size is small and weak.
CONCEPT 4: SOCIAL LOAFINGDefinition: Social loafing occurs when persons are
performing a task as part of a group and individual effort cannot be identified.
After competing in the tournament, Joe’s teammates did not praised him for his contribution towards the team. From there, he was very disappointed because his individual contribution and effort cannot be identified.
CONCEPT 5: SELF-FULFILLING PROPHECY
Definition: Self-fulfilling prophecy is a predictions
that directly or indirectly cause itself to become true, by the very terms of the prophecy itself, due to positive feedback between belief and behaviour.
Joe’s brother comfort Joe and tell him not to give up. He have faith in Joe that he can accomplish anything just like everyone else. He decided to guide through intensive training.
